如何实现mysql json 设置某个json数组为json

引言

作为一名经验丰富的开发者,我们经常会遇到一些新手开发者不知道如何实现某些功能的情况。今天我们就来看一下如何在mysql中设置某个json数组为json。我们将通过一系列步骤来教会新手开发者如何实现这个功能。

流程图

classDiagram
    class 新手开发者 {
        步骤1
        步骤2
        步骤3
    }
    class 经验丰富的开发者 {
        步骤1
        步骤2
        步骤3
    }
    新手开发者 --> 经验丰富的开发者: 学习

步骤

以下是实现“mysql json 设置某个json数组为json”的步骤:

步骤 描述
步骤1 连接到mysql数据库
步骤2 选择要设置json数组为json的表
步骤3 使用json_set函数设置json数组为json

代码示例及解释

步骤1:连接到mysql数据库

-- 连接到mysql数据库
mysql -u 用户名 -p

这段代码是用来连接到mysql数据库的命令。输入用户名和密码后即可连接到数据库。

步骤2:选择要设置json数组为json的表

-- 选择要设置json数组为json的表
use 数据库名;

这段代码是切换到指定数据库的命令。将“数据库名”替换为实际的数据库名即可。

步骤3:使用json_set函数设置json数组为json

-- 使用json_set函数设置json数组为json
update 表名 set 列名 = json_set(列名, '$[0].key', 'value') where 条件;

这段代码是将json数组中第一个元素的key值设置为value。其中,“表名”为实际的表名,“列名”为实际的列名,“条件”为更新条件。

结论

通过以上步骤,我们可以很容易地在mysql中设置某个json数组为json。希望新手开发者可以通过这篇文章学习到相关知识,提升自己的技能水平。祝大家编程愉快!


在这篇文章中,我们用步骤、代码示例和解释的方式,详细介绍了如何在mysql中设置某个json数组为json。希望能给读者带来一些帮助,更好地理解和掌握这个功能的实现方式。